How could you use suspiciousness in a sentence?

Here are some examples of how to use "suspiciousness" in a sentence:

Neutral:

* Her suspiciousness towards strangers made it difficult for her to make new friends.

* The detective's suspiciousness led him to uncover the truth behind the crime.

* The suspiciousness surrounding the company's financial dealings was enough to make investors hesitant.

Negative:

* His suspiciousness of everyone around him made him seem paranoid.

* The suspiciousness between the two neighbors escalated into a full-blown feud.

* The suspiciousness surrounding the politician's campaign was a sign of possible corruption.

Positive:

* A healthy amount of suspiciousness is important when dealing with online scams.

* The suspiciousness of the security guard prevented a potential robbery.

* The suspiciousness of the child's behavior alerted the teacher to a possible issue at home.

The tone of the sentence will depend on the context and the specific situation you are describing.
